Output 674d32103d022c42e5610d133bb8016519ced023e14d80c7e66c6e5798792917:65

value
1140901
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f1957a149fa5f09fd062b0acda201705a79e9c7f OP_EQUAL
address
3PiPqcMbi1t2qbQricvSajbnqBNUT6zQFm
transaction
674d32103d022c42e5610d133bb8016519ced023e14d80c7e66c6e5798792917
spent
true